Esther was born on January 17, 1919 to Otto and Mary (Brehmer) Rabe at Wisner, Nebraska. She grew there on the farm. She was baptized on Febr. 9, 1919 in St. Paul's Lutheran Church at Wisner, and confirmed in the same church on May 22, 1932. She attended rural Cuming County schools and graduated from Wisner High School in the class of 1937.

On December 23, 1939, Esther was married to Emil Roeber in St. Paul's Lutheran Church in Wisner. They lived on farms near Wisner, then near Bancroft. In 1950, Esther and Emil moved to Fremont. Esther worked for Mode O Day (ladies wear) and for the Mead Ordnance Plant. She retired in 1978 after working for Western Electric in Millard for 21 years. Esther was a member of Trinity Lutheran Church.

Esther was preceded in death by her husband Emil in September of 1998, and by a brother and 7 sisters.
